HIPAA's Security Rule incorporates three specific standards for security of electronic information, including:
a. Personal safeguards.
b. Family safeguards.
c. Physical safeguards.
d. Occupational safeguards.
Answer: c
Feedback: HIPAA's Security Rule incorporates three specific standards for security of electronic information: administrative safeguards, physical safeguards, and technical safeguards.
